发明名称 Bi-convex airship
摘要 An airship comprises a shell having a bi-convex shape, wherein the shell encompasses a volume, and a gas storage system located within the volume.

主权项 1. An airship comprising: a shell having a lateral vertical cross-section bi-convex shape comprising a substantially planar structure configured to resist tension forces of a membrane comprising a first arc and a second arc, such that the planar structure substantially aligns with a longitudinal axis and a lateral axis of the shell, and a width of the shell relative to a horizontal axis differs from a height of the shell, and the shell encompasses a volume; a gas storage system located within the volume, such that the gas storage system comprises multiple cells within the volume, and at least one cell comprises a combination of a lighter than air gas bag within a hot air section, the gas within the gas storage system comprising a lighter than air gas; an air storage system located within the volume, wherein the air storage system comprises a ventilation system, wherein the ventilation system comprises controllable vents and inlet fans; a heating system, wherein the heating system comprises at least one of: a propulsion system, a heater unit, and a heat exchange system connected to a set of heat generating components; and a controller, wherein the controller is configured to control a temperature of air in the air storage system to: control a buoyancy of the airship, and adjust the buoyancy of the airship to enable the airship to ascend without using aerodynamic lift and without using a vertical thrust component from the propulsion system.
